The Remote Desktop Team is part of the Cloud and Enterprise Division. The Remote Desktop team has developed a mature business with desktop and app remoting. Our team is focused on supporting our existing business and optimizing our solutions for deployments in Azure. We develop client applications on all major platforms to support our existing business, personal desktop connections, and our new RDS modern infrastructure. As an engineer on the remote desktop team, you will work on the next generation of Remote Desktop services that are built for both hosters and enterprises. The work will involve improving the experiences of users when running in remote computing environments. You will work on making a user's profile roaming experience as fast, and seamless as possible when they are moving between different remote computers.
